Informed Families, a non-profit 501(c)3 organization is a broad-based, grass roots volunteer/parent organization that is affiliated with the National Family Partnership. Informed Families is an education, training and support center for parents, schools and communities to help raise safe, healthy and drug-free children. We teach people how to say no to drugs and how to make healthy choices. To reduce the demand for drugs, Informed Families has focused its efforts on educating and mobilizing the community, parents and young people in order to change attitudes and thereby counteract the pressures in society that condone and promote drug and alcohol use and abuse. The organization educates thousands of families annually on how to stay drug and alcohol free through networking and a series of programs and services.

Informed Families/The Florida Family Partnership is a statewide organization with offices in Miami, Orlando, Tampa, Pensacola, and Jacksonville.

Did You Know???

The number one reason kids give for not using drugs is their parents! However, 40% of parents believe they have little influence on their childrens drug use. Worse, 50% of parents expect their children will use drugs. When we ask kids what they would like us to do to help with the drug problem, the surprising answer is talk to our parents about drugs.
